I am considering purchasing long-term health care insurance and I'm wondering when would be the best time to buy it. Can anyone provide some guidance on this? Thanks!

Long-term health care insurance is designed to cover the costs of long-term care services, such as nursing home care, assisted living, and in-home care. It provides financial protection in case you need these services in the future. The best time to buy long-term health care insurance is when you are younger and in good health. This is because premiums are generally lower when you are younger and have fewer health issues. Waiting until you are older or have health problems may result in higher premiums or even being denied coverage. It's important to note that eligibility requirements and premium rates vary among insurance providers, so it's a good idea to shop around and compare different policies. Additionally, it's recommended to consider your financial situation and long-term care needs when deciding on the coverage amount and duration of the policy. Consulting with a financial advisor or insurance specialist can help you make an informed decision. Keep in mind that long-term health care insurance is not for everyone, and it's important to carefully evaluate your own needs and circumstances before making a purchase decision.
